Attacked by the Invisible
by Anonymous

Back in 1982, when I was 12 years old, I made it a habit to ride my bike to where my dad had his town board meetings at night. At least until this incident.

I lived in a very small town at the time. When the meeting finished, it was dark outside. The building was on the edge of town next to a cemetery. My dad was still in his meeting, so I just put my bike in the back of his pickup truck and climbed into the cab and waited. I rolled down the window because it was a warm summer night. I had only been sitting there waiting for a few minutes when all of a sudden the chain-link fence started to rattle really hard, like something was climbing over it. This fence was about 35 or 40 feet from the truck I was sitting in and was also well lit by the overhead parking lot lamp. So I know that if there would have been a real physical human or creature I would have been able to clearly see it. On my side of the fence and right next to the fence was a short stack of corrugated roofing tin lying on the ground.

The fence started to rattle for a few seconds and then it sounded just like someone or something jumped down and landed loudly on the roofing tin, but I could see nothing there. I heard two or three steps on the tin and then a bunch of rapid and loud foot steps in the gravel walking directly toward the truck that I was sitting in. I was horrified at the fact that I could not see anyone coming toward me. I quickly rolled up the window and locked both doors.

Just as I locked the doors, the entire truck started to violently rock back and forth. Even a much stronger rock than a normal human being would be able to do. I sat in the very center of the cab on the verge of tears. The rocking lasted for maybe 30 seconds and then completely stopped. After awhile my dad came out and got in the truck with me. I told him about what happened and he scoffed at me. He didn't believe me at all.

It was impossible for this to have been imagined. I know that it was real. I have always been in tune with the "supernatural" and have many other stories of real things. Many of which I do not tell. I even got involved with Black Magic to an obsessive degree. Now I am a very active Christian. I am not scared of the dark side at all. Demons still come and bother me once and awhile but I have, know that I am perfectly safe now. I just cast them away in the name of Jesus Christ.
